首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Boto3不删除S3或数字海洋空间中的对象

Boto3是一个用于与亚马逊AWS云服务进行交互的Python软件开发工具包。它提供了丰富的API,用于管理和操作AWS云服务中的各种资源,包括S3对象存储和数字海洋空间。

在Boto3中,要删除S3或数字海洋空间中的对象,可以使用delete_object方法。该方法接受一个Bucket参数,指定要删除对象的存储桶名称,以及一个Key参数,指定要删除的对象的键(即对象的唯一标识符)。

以下是一个示例代码,演示如何使用Boto3删除S3中的对象:

代码语言:txt
复制
import boto3

# 创建S3客户端
s3 = boto3.client('s3')

# 指定要删除的对象的存储桶名称和对象键
bucket_name = 'your_bucket_name'
object_key = 'your_object_key'

# 删除对象
s3.delete_object(Bucket=bucket_name, Key=object_key)

在上述示例中,需要将your_bucket_name替换为实际的存储桶名称,将your_object_key替换为要删除的对象的键。

Boto3还提供了其他用于管理S3和数字海洋空间的方法,例如上传对象、下载对象、列出对象等。您可以通过查阅Boto3的官方文档来了解更多详细信息和示例代码。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云对象存储(COS):腾讯云提供的高可靠、低成本的对象存储服务,适用于存储和处理大规模非结构化数据。详情请参考:腾讯云对象存储(COS)

请注意,以上答案中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,以符合问题要求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券